Primary Responsibilities
The Logistics Multi-Mode Account Manager will be responsible for managing a team of logistics coordinators to ensure smooth and efficient execution of various logistics programs along with monitoring operational performance, fostering relationships with customers, carriers, freight forwarders, and warehouse partners, and driving continuous improvement initiatives. Essential Functions
DUTIES, TASKS A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
* Develops and maintains relationships with customers, carriers, freight forwarders, and 3rd party warehouse companies.
* Gathers feedback to understand evolving needs, identify opportunities for additional logistics services, and provide solutions accordingly.
* Drives improvement actions based on feedback received from customers, carriers, freight forwarders, and warehouse partners.
* Manages a team of logistics Planners and Specialists, sets performance expectations, and provides necessary tools and resources for the team.
* Monitors team execution and holds them accountable for meeting high-performance standards.
* Conducts regular reviews, provides feedback and training for employee growth and development.
* Oversee operational tasks such as order entry, planning, optimization, shipment tendering, appointment scheduling, track and trace, closure, and the resolution of exceptions and OS&Ds.
* Manages and coordinates end-to-end multi-leg transportation, ensuring seamless transitions between modes (road, air, maritime, and barge) while optimizing costs, transit times, and service reliability.
* Ensures timely and accurate processing of orders, shipments, and customer updates.
* Supervises load management and freight audits to maintain accuracy and compliance.
* Processes pricing inquiries about customer development for new business opportunities.
* Responds to pricing requests originating from existing customer accounts, providing rules and provisions around pricing structures.
* Manages escalations and addresses issues outside the scope of the team.
* Coordinates with other departments to resolve issues.
* Monitors planning and routing to ensure customer and commodity requirements are met and cargo space is optimized.
* Analyzes P&L by customer, identifies trends, and addresses problem areas to maintain a healthy P&L.
* Continuously evaluates current processes and technology usage to identify areas for improvement.
* Drives initiatives to optimize performance and increase efficiency while meeting customer requirements.
* Facilitates onboarding for new customers, understanding their requirements, pricing information, and resource options.
* Provides initial orientation and training for new hires and ongoing training for team members.
* Conducts daily planning and coordination meetings to address current issues, make decisions, and delegate tasks.
* Supports the administrative team with billing issues and questions as needed.
* Works cross-functionally with internal teams to meet the company's vision and goals.
